What does the word "Electrotype" mean?

The term "electrotype" is a fascinating concept that bridges the gap between traditional printing methods and modern technological advancements. It refers to a process that allows for the reproduction of type or illustrations using electrolysis. The electrotype method has a rich history, particularly in the printing industry, where it revolutionized the way printed materials were produced.

The origins of electrotyping date back to the early 19th century, when it was discovered that metal could be deposited around a model through electrolytic processes. The most commonly used metal for this purpose is copper. This technique is particularly useful in creating plates that can be used in letterpress printing, which was the predominant method of printing at the time.

Here’s a simplified overview of how the electrotyping process works:

  1. Model Creation: An initial model of the type or illustration is made, often using a material that can easily be molded, such as wax or plaster.
  2. Conductive Coating: The model is then coated with a conductive material, usually graphite. This step is crucial for the electrolysis process to take place.
  3. Electrolytic Bath: The prepared model is submerged in an electrolytic solution, which contains metal ions. A current is passed through this solution to initiate the deposition of metal onto the surface of the model.
  4. Plate Formation: After a sufficient amount of metal has been deposited, the resulting electrotype plate is carefully removed from the model. The plate can then be further processed, such as being hardened or polished.

One of the significant advantages of electrotyping is that it enables the mass production of types or illustrations without the need to create multiple original molds. This not only saves time but also reduces costs, making it an efficient option for printing large quantities of materials.

Historically, electrotypes were widely used in book publishing, allowing publishers to reprint popular works with ease. Additionally, the ability to reproduce detailed images meant that illustrations could be included in printed materials, enhancing the visual appeal of books and newspapers.

Today, while traditional electrotyping has been largely replaced by digital printing technologies, the principles behind the process remain relevant in various fields, including metalworking and the creation of complex artistic objects.
